Find a Lawyer in RajkotAbout Intellectual Property Law in Rajkot, India
Intellectual Property (IP) law deals with the legal rights associated with creations of the mind such as inventions, literary and artistic works, symbols, names, images, and designs used in commerce. In Rajkot, a growing industrial and business hub of Gujarat, IP rights are increasingly valuable as entrepreneurs, manufacturers, and creators seek to protect their ideas and innovations. Indian IP law is governed primarily by central acts and enforced locally by authorities and legal professionals in Rajkot, making it essential for stakeholders to understand how these laws operate within the city's context.

Local Laws Overview
While the core legal framework for Intellectual Property in Rajkot originates from national legislation, its implementation and practical aspects often have regional nuances. Key laws include:
- The Patents Act, 1970 for inventions
- The Trade Marks Act, 1999 for brand names, logos, and symbols
- The Copyright Act, 1957 for literary, artistic, musical, and other works
- The Designs Act, 2000 for aesthetic designs of products
- The Geographical Indications of Goods (Registration & Protection) Act, 1999 for products unique to specific regions
Rajkot falls under the jurisdiction of the Gujarat branch offices of the Controller General of Patents, Designs and Trade Marks, and related tribunals. Local lawyers play a vital role in ensuring correct filing, representation, prosecution, opposition, and enforcement procedures are followed. IP litigation or disputes may be heard at the appropriate district courts or tribunals located in Gujarat.
Frequently Asked Questions
What kinds of creations can be protected by Intellectual Property law in Rajkot?
IP law covers inventions, brand names, logos, creative works like books or music, design elements, and region-specific products. Each category falls under different registration and protection rules.
Where do I register a patent, trademark, or copyright in Rajkot?
Registrations are made at the government’s regional IP offices. Applications can be filed online or through an authorized agent in Rajkot. For patents and trademarks, applications go to the Indian Patent Office or Trademarks Registry. For copyrights, the Indian Copyright Office is the authority.
How long does protection last under different types of IP?
Patent protection lasts 20 years, trademarks can be renewed indefinitely every 10 years, copyrights last for the lifetime of the author plus 60 years, and registered designs are protected for 10 years, extendable by 5 more years.
What do I do if someone in Rajkot is using my logo or brand name without permission?
Contact a local IP lawyer immediately. They can advise on sending a legal notice, negotiating a settlement, or initiating court proceedings for infringement, depending on the situation.
Can I protect my idea without formal registration?
While some rights exist by default, such as copyright upon creation, formal registration is highly recommended for patents, trademarks, and designs as it provides stronger legal protection and easier enforcement.
Are there penalties for IP infringement in Rajkot?
Yes, IP infringement can result in civil remedies like injunctions, damages, and account of profits. In some cases, criminal penalties such as fines and imprisonment may also apply.
How do I object if someone tries to register a similar trademark in Rajkot?
After a trademark is advertised in the official journal, objections can be filed through an opposition proceeding. A local lawyer can help prepare and submit the necessary documents.
Do I need an IP agent or lawyer to file applications in Rajkot?
Although individuals can file some applications themselves, an IP agent or lawyer is recommended to ensure compliance with technical requirements and to handle any legal complexities.
Can traditional knowledge or folk art be protected by IP law in Rajkot?
Some aspects may be protected under copyright, design, or geographical indications, but the law in this area is evolving. A specialized IP lawyer can assess eligibility and advise on protection mechanisms.
Is foreign IP protection valid in India and Rajkot?
International IP rights are not automatically recognized in India. To enforce IP in Rajkot, you need to apply for protection under Indian law or use relevant international treaties, such as the Patent Cooperation Treaty. Consult an IP lawyer for assistance.
